Study On The Lfc Process Of Composite Wear-resistant Bend Pipe With High Chromium Cast Iron - High Manganese Steel

The paper explores the process of bimetal composite bend pipe manufactured by LFC in a common manufacture condition, emphatically studies the casting process of making the bimetal metallurgical fusion.According to the structure attributes of bend pipe and physical feature of the used materials, a basic line of the bimetal lost foam casting process has been draw up.Under a common manufacture condition, some important parameters of casting process are confirmed for the bimetal composite bend pipe. By experiments, the skills are summarized for preparing wear-resistant pattern casting, composite bend pipe foam, painting coating and assembling pouring system.Founding out the cause of the master defects of composite bend pipe casting, the methods to improve the quality of pipe casting are gained by experiments.Scanning by electron microscopy, the mechanical properties of the pipe are verified.
